RIP: Sir Christopher Lee. We Couldn't Have Asked For a Better Saruman [VIDEO]
Jun 12, 2015 09:06
A true legend has passed away. Sir Christopher Lee has died at the age of 93, according to a report from The Telegraph. He reportedly died at 8.30am on Sunday at Chelsea and Westminster Hospital after he suffered respiratory problems and heart failure.
His career has spanned eight decades, taking him from cult TV to mega blockbusters like Lord of the Rings and Star Wars.
